Tel Aviv: The Israeli Defense Minister ordered a complete blockade of Gaza.
According to the news agency, Israel's Defense Minister Yves Gallant has ordered a complete blockade of Gaza after the heavy attacks of Hamas.
The foreign news agency told that Israeli Defense Minister has ordered the authorities to cut off the electricity in Gaza.
Apart from this, the Israeli Defense Minister has also issued orders to stop the supply of food and drinks to Gaza.
On the other hand, media reports have stated that Hamas fighters entered the border from the southern region of Israel on Monday, where they destroyed the fence with tanks.
While the Palestinian Ministry of Health said that the number of martyrs in Gaza so far is around 500, and more than 2700 Palestinians have been injured.
According to the Palestinian Foreign Ministry, Israel has also targeted the United Nations school in Gaza, where thousands of civilians, including children, were present. While the United Nations has also confirmed the attack on the school.
In addition, the United Nations stated that after the war between Israel and Hamas, more than 123,000 people in Gaza have been displaced due to damage to their homes and fear.
According to the United Nations, more than 73,000 people have taken refuge in schools in Gaza.
A spokesperson for the United Nations Human Rights Organization said that before the Israeli attack on Gaza, 2.3 million people were living there.
